Kinder Bueno. Kinder Bueno (kinder is German for “children”, bueno is Spanish for “good”) is a chocolate bar made by Italian confectionery maker Ferrero. Kinder Bueno, part of the Kinder Chocolate brand line, is a hazelnut cream filled wafer with a chocolate covering.Kinder chocolate was first introduced to the German market in 1968 and quickly hit the Italian market that same year before spreading to other countries in the Mediterranean region. The chocolate is still being produced in Germany and Italy.KINDER BUENO IS NOW AVAILABLE IN THE USA!

Who made kinder?

The story of the KINDER™ brand begins in 1968 at the heart of a small Italian town named Alba. Michele Ferrero developed KINDER CHOCOLATE and added what would become a famous brand for the Ferrero company, which remains family owned today.

Where is Nutella from?

After World War II, cocoa was extremely scarce. Ferrero, originally from Piedmont in Italy, turned this tricky problem into a smart solution, creating a sweet paste made from hazelnuts, sugar and just a little of the rare cocoa. The ancestor of Nutella® was born.

Is Kinder Bueno illegal?

The Kinder Bueno bars are the second product to hit the states. After initially being banned due to a 1930s law banning candy stuffed with non-food objects, Kinder Eggs, a chocolate egg with a toy inside, were not legally accepted in the US.

Should I use Bien or Bueno?

Going back to our two words, then, ‘bien’ is used to describe a verb, and usually translates as “well”. ‘Bueno’ is used to describe nouns and translates as “good”.
